Khalid Medani is an Associate Professor in the Department of Political Science at McGill University. His research specializes in Comparative Government Politics, focusing on various aspects of African Politics, Islamic Politics, Informal Economies, Middle East Politics, Ethnic Civil Conflict, and Comparative Politics. Medani's current book project examines the intersections of globalization, informal markets, and collective action in the development of Islamic ethnic politics in regions such as Egypt, Sudan, and Somalia. He has actively contributed to the field through various presentations at conferences, including topics on political economy and the influence of globalization on Islamic militancy. His extensive academic background also includes a PhD from the University of California, Berkeley, contributing to both scholarly and practical discourses in political science and development studies.
